Motor Specs and Power Delivery Solutions

Electric motors transform electric power into mechanical rotation, and the fisca shop automobiles make use of cleaned or brushless motor configurations relying on performance needs and planned usage strength. Brushed motors utilize physical contact in between carbon brushes and commutator sectors to supply existing to rotor windings, creating magnetic fields that drive turning. These motors offer simple building and lower expense, ideal for entry-level fisca plaything store designs planned for laid-back operation. Brushless motors eliminate physical contact with digital commutation, making use of hall-effect sensing units or sensorless algorithms to time existing shipment to stator windings. This arrangement supplies premium efficiency, higher power thickness, and extended operational life given that no brush wear happens.

Electric motor specs consist of KV rating, which indicates RPM per volt used, figuring out the electric motor’s rate and torque qualities. Lower KV rankings produce greater torque at lower rates, advantageous for creeping applications and steep slope climbing, while higher KV rankings deliver better top speed at the expenditure of torque. The fisca toy shop option matches motor requirements to car applications, making certain suitable power features for the desired usage. Electronic rate controllers control existing flow to electric motors, equating control inputs into precise throttle response while including defense functions like low-voltage cutoff, thermal limiting, and brake functionality. These controllers use pulse-width modulation to differ efficient voltage delivery, allowing smooth rate control throughout the operating variety.

Radio Control Solution and Signal Processing

The fisca official radio systems utilize 2.4 GHz regularity bands that offer premium interference resistance contrasted to older MHz systems, instantly picking optimal channels via frequency-hopping spread spectrum modern technology. The transmitter produces control signals inscribing guiding and throttle inputs, regulating these onto superhigh frequency service provider waves broadcast to the vehicle. The receiver demodulates inbound signals, removing control data and converting these into electric signals that drive servo electric motors and speed controllers. This electronic signal processing allows several cars to run all at once without disturbance, each transmitter-receiver pair connecting on distinct network projects.

Servo electric motors manage steering mechanisms, converting electrical signals into specific angular positioning of steering links. These servos incorporate potentiometers that provide setting comments, allowing closed-loop control that preserves commanded angles despite outside forces from terrain communication. Servo requirements consist of torque score measured in kilogram-centimeters, indicating the force available for steering actuation, and rate rating determined in seconds per 60 levels of rotation. The fisca online automobiles set servo specs with guiding geometry, guaranteeing adequate pressure to get rid of tire friction while offering action speed proper for lorry agility. Battery Innovation and Power Storage Space Solutions

Power storage space straight impacts car efficiency and procedure period, with the fisca toy brand name utilizing lithium polymer batteries that offer premium energy thickness contrasted to older nickel-metal hydride chemistry. These LiPo batteries package lithium-ion chemistry in versatile polymer pouches instead of rigid metal cases, making it possible for product packaging setups enhanced for lorry area restrictions. Battery specs consist of capacity measured in milliamp-hours, showing overall power storage, and discharge rate specified as C-rating, showing maximum safe present distribution. A 1000mAh battery with 20C discharge ranking can securely provide 20 amps continually, providing the present required for high-performance motors throughout velocity and climbing.

Battery configuration uses collection and parallel cell setups to achieve required voltage and capability requirements. Series connection adds cell voltages while keeping ability, with two arrangements supplying 7.4 V nominal and 3S providing 11.1 V, while identical link adds capability while keeping voltage. The store fisca inventory includes cars created for specific battery arrangements, with electronic components rated for the matching voltages. Battery monitoring consists of balance charging that makes certain specific cells within multi-cell packs reach similar voltage levels, protecting against capability discrepancy that would certainly minimize pack performance and lifespan. Security circuits keep an eye on cell voltages, disconnecting loads when specific cells approach minimal safe voltage limits, avoiding over-discharge damage that would permanently minimize capability.

Charging Solutions and Battery Upkeep

Proper billing procedures dramatically impact battery long life and security, with lithium polymer chemistry requiring constant-current/constant-voltage billing accounts that supply specified current up until cells get to 4.2 V per cell, then preserve that voltage while existing progressively lowers to cutoff limit. The buy fisca plans usually consist of chargers matched to car battery specifications, set up for proper present delivery and cell matter. Balance charging adapters enable private cell monitoring throughout charging, making sure all cells reach identical fee states in spite of small ability variations between cells. Storage charge performance charges or discharges batteries to roughly 3.8 V per cell, the optimum voltage for extended storage that decreases destruction from schedule aging.

Battery maintenance consists of routine evaluation for physical damage, swelling that indicates interior gas generation, or port damage that can create resistance and warm generation. Proper storage keeps batteries in temperature-controlled settings away from conductive products that can short circuit terminals.
